Output 79a147587bb89fa90cad39406e7063b8178497b50bef97e8fecf93118dbf567a:78

value
33639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 091f186ab8ada1637e4c02bdbc66caa25b5e9bac OP_EQUAL
address
32XFFpDudjG81injr14kZqjwh7oRpMK8do
transaction
79a147587bb89fa90cad39406e7063b8178497b50bef97e8fecf93118dbf567a